London Underground

Train drivers’ union Aslef called for an urgent review of security after a night Tube driver was kicked and sprayed with paint by vandals. BBC News

Union leaders have called for the Night Tube service to be suspended to pay for Transport for London spending cuts. Evening Standard

TfL says major Tube upgrades on Northern Line and Jubilee Line cancelled because of unexpected dip in passenger numbers CityAM

Transport for London to cut 1400 jobs, according to RMT Union IMECHE

The machines drilling two new tube tunnels under South London have broken through at Kennington, having started their work at Battersea Power Station. IanVisits
